Least Common Multiple of 85488 and 85496 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 85488 and 85496, than apply into the LCM equation.

GCF(85488,85496) = 8
LCM(85488,85496) = ( 85488 × 85496) / 8
LCM(85488,85496) = 7308882048 / 8
LCM(85488,85496) = 913610256
